What does the Orange Light indicate?

The orange light on your Panoramic WiFi Gateway serves as an indicator of a potential issue with your internet connection. It can signify several different things, including:

  • Internet Connectivity Problems: If the orange light is flashing or solid, it may indicate that your Panoramic WiFi Gateway is having trouble connecting to the internet. This could be due to a problem with your ISP (Internet Service Provider) or issues with the network settings.
  • Router Configuration Issues: Sometimes, an orange light can suggest that there are configuration problems with your router. This might include incorrect settings, outdated firmware, or conflicts with other devices on your network.
  • Hardware Malfunction: In some cases, the orange light could be a sign of a hardware malfunction. This could be related to the Panoramic WiFi Gateway itself or any connected devices such as modems or cables.

Steps to Troubleshoot the Orange Light

If you encounter the orange light on your Panoramic WiFi Gateway, here are some steps you can take to troubleshoot the issue:

  1. Restart your Panoramic WiFi Gateway: Begin by turning off your Panoramic WiFi Gateway and unplugging it from the power source. Wait for about 30 seconds and then plug it back in. Allow the device to boot up and check if the orange light persists.
  2. Check your Internet Connection: Make sure that your internet connection is active and working properly. Test the connection by connecting a device directly to the modem or accessing the internet through a different network to determine if the issue lies with your Panoramic WiFi Gateway or the ISP.
  3. Review Network Settings: Access the administrative interface of your Panoramic WiFi Gateway by entering its IP address into a web browser. Check if all the network settings are configured correctly, including DHCP, DNS, and IP addressing. If necessary, consult the user manual or contact your ISP for assistance.
  4. Update Firmware: Ensure that your Panoramic WiFi Gateway’s firmware is up to date. Outdated firmware can cause compatibility issues and may lead to the orange light problem. Visit the manufacturer’s website or contact customer support for instructions on how to update the firmware.
  5. Inspect Hardware Connections: Verify that all cables connected to your Panoramic WiFi Gateway and other devices are securely plugged in. Check for any physical damage or loose connections that could be causing the orange light issue.
